"reason": "RcppParallel bundles an old Intel TBB whose build fails on musl and modern toolchains (g++ 8-15 + modern make); link the system oneTBB (2021+) instead, keeping the TBB backend so dependents (rstan, ...) link TBB. All build-env platforms now provide oneTBB 2021+: native on alpine/ubuntu/el10, built from source into /usr/local on el8/el9 (their stock TBB is classic 2018/2020, too old)."
